Winter Home Risks: Beyond the Basics

Beyond the Basics: A Deeper Look at Winter Home Risks

The core threats outlined in previous years remain relevant: frozen pipes, ice dams, snow load, furnace issues, and generator safety. However, the increasing frequency and intensity of extreme weather events necessitate a more comprehensive approach to preparedness. The lessons learned from the severe winter of 2023-24, which saw unprecedented ice dam formation across the state, underscore the need for vigilance.

1. Frozen Pipes: Embracing Smart Technology for Protection

Frozen pipes continue to be a significant threat, and the expansion of smart home technology offers new preventative options. While insulation and dripping faucets remain crucial, installing smart water shut-off valves can automatically detect drops in pipe temperature and shut off the water supply, preventing potentially catastrophic bursts. These devices, remotely managed through smartphone apps, can even provide alerts about freezing conditions, enabling proactive intervention. New pipe heating cables, utilizing energy-efficient thermoelectric technology, are also becoming increasingly popular for added protection, particularly in vulnerable areas. Beyond simple dripping, some homeowners are installing low-flow, temperature-controlled drip systems, minimizing water waste.

2. Ice Dams: Enhanced Ventilation and Roof Monitoring

Ice dam formation remains a persistent problem, often linked to inadequate attic insulation and ventilation. The use of drone-based thermal imaging is now widely accessible, allowing homeowners to identify heat loss areas and potential ice dam hotspots before they develop. Traditional methods like improved insulation and roof raking are still vital, but advancements in roof membrane technology offer improved water resistance and the ability to prevent water intrusion even in compromised areas. Furthermore, heated roof cables, powered by solar panels, are emerging as a sustainable solution for actively melting snow and preventing ice dam formation.

3. Snow Load: Structural Assessment and Load Monitoring

The risk of roof collapse due to snow load remains a serious concern. Increased adoption of building information modeling (BIM) during construction has led to more structurally sound homes, but regular assessment is still required. Some newer homes and commercial buildings are incorporating snow load sensors that wirelessly transmit data to homeowners, providing real-time information about roof stress. These sensors, coupled with weather forecasts, allow for proactive snow removal and prevent structural failure. Local building codes now increasingly mandate roof structural assessments every five years in areas with high snowfall.

4. Furnace Troubles: Predictive Maintenance and Hybrid Systems

Furnace breakdowns are frequently costly and inconvenient. Regular maintenance remains the cornerstone of prevention, but the introduction of predictive maintenance programs, leveraging machine learning to analyze furnace performance data, is growing. These programs can identify potential issues before they escalate, allowing for targeted repairs and minimizing downtime. Furthermore, the increasing popularity of hybrid heating systems - combining traditional furnaces with heat pumps - improves energy efficiency and reduces the strain on the furnace during peak demand periods.

5. Generator Safety: Smart Generators and Carbon Monoxide Detection

With increasing frequency of power outages, generators are essential backup power sources. Modern smart generators automatically detect low oil levels, monitor exhaust temperatures, and provide remote status updates via smartphone apps. Carbon monoxide detectors are absolutely essential, and the integration of these detectors with smart home systems allows for immediate alerts and automatic generator shut-off in the event of CO leaks. Furthermore, the rollout of microgrids and community-level battery storage systems is gradually reducing reliance on individual generators.

Seeking Professional Expertise - A Proactive Approach

While many preventative measures can be undertaken by homeowners, the complexity of some issues - roof assessments, furnace diagnostics, and electrical system modifications - necessitates professional assistance. Annual inspections by qualified professionals are a prudent investment, providing peace of mind and preventing costly surprises. Remember, proactive preparedness is the key to a safe and comfortable Michigan winter in 2026.
